MARETRON MPower CLMD12-R, is designed for vessels of all sizes with smaller loads, the MPower CLMD12 is a compact 12-channel DC Load Controller Module. Two of the 12 switches can handle a maximum load of 12 amperes, six can handle a maximum load of 10 amperes, and four can handle a maximum load of 5 amperes, with a total current capacity of 75 amperes. In addition, circuits can be paralleled.

If a smaller circuit needs protection, each switch can be set to trip at lower current levels using the new Maretron N2KAnalyzer® V3 software. The CLMD12 also has inputs for up to 7 hardwired switches that can be used to control switch status or to input data such as alarms from bilge pumps, hatch positions, and more.

The CLMD12 handles many types of DC loads, such as lights, pumps, motors, and electronics. An additional benefit is that the module reports the current consumption for each switch. This makes it possible to determine if loads are drawing too much or too little current. This information can be used to report overcurrent faults and undercurrent conditions, such as broken lights.

For manual control of loads, an optional MPower 12-channel bypass module (CBMD12) can be installed with the CLMD12.

Features

  • NMEA 2000 interface
  • IP67 rated
  • Ignition protected
  • Opto-isolated from NMEA 2000®, eliminating potential ground loop issues
  • Twelve (12) dimmable Electronic Circuit Breakers (ECB) for On/Off control via the NMEA 2000® network
    • 2 switches handle up to 12 amperes
    • 6 switches handle up to 10 amperes
    • 4 switches handle up to 5 amperes
    • Individual monitoring of electrical current for each switch
  • Switches can have defined start states (ON, OFF, or PREVIOUS STATE)
  • Switches can be locked to prevent accidental activation
  • Seven (7) discrete inputs configurable as active high or active low
  • Automatic shutdown for overcurrent for ECB
  • Automatic thermal shutdown for ECB (overtemperature protection)
